Fiona Cai is an undergraduate researcher at MIT studying Computer Science and Engineering. She is fascinated by the bridging of computation, engineering, and healthcare, and is specifically interested in exploring the field of medical devices.

Her previous work includes a bioinformatics project at the Brigham and Women’s hospital that leveraged electronic healthcare data to streamline clinical trial recruitment and biostatistics research on improving phenotyping algorithms at the Harvard School of Public Health.

Fiona is looking forward to becoming a part of the Conformable Decoders group and working on research that explores novel materials, device design, and implementing effective, energy harvesting medical devices. She hopes to develop and refine her skills in applied computer science and materials science while conducting research to contribute to the greater healthcare community.
